About the Specialization
What is Mathematics Education at The Oxford College of Education Bengaluru?
This Mathematics Education program at The Oxford College of Education, affiliated with Bangalore North University, focuses on equipping future teachers with advanced pedagogical skills and a deep understanding of mathematical concepts for effective classroom delivery. It addresses the critical need for skilled mathematics educators in India''''s evolving education system, aiming to foster critical thinking and problem-solving abilities in students from primary to secondary levels, aligning with NEP 2020 objectives.
Who Should Apply?
This program is ideal for science or engineering graduates with a strong mathematics background seeking to transition into the teaching profession. It also suits existing teachers looking to specialize and enhance their instructional methodologies in mathematics, as well as passionate individuals committed to shaping the mathematical aptitude of young learners across various educational boards in India, particularly those aspiring for roles in K-12 education.

Student Success Practices
Foundation Stage
Master Foundational Pedagogical Theories- (Semester 1-2)
Actively engage with theories of child development, learning, and teaching methods discussed in core papers. Form study groups to discuss and apply these theories to real classroom scenarios, focusing on understanding diverse learners and developing initial teaching philosophies.
Tools & Resources
NCERT textbooks on educational psychology, B.Ed reference books, online academic forums for education, peer discussions
Career Connection
A strong theoretical base is crucial for developing effective lesson plans, managing classrooms efficiently, and excelling in teacher eligibility tests and interviews, laying the groundwork for a competent teaching career.
Build Strong Content Knowledge in Mathematics- (Semester 1-2)
Beyond the pedagogy papers, revisit and solidify your understanding of school-level mathematics concepts (e.g., algebra, geometry, calculus basics). Practice solving problems, explore alternative solutions, and understand common misconceptions students face to enhance your teaching clarity.
Tools & Resources
NCERT Maths textbooks (Class VI-XII), online platforms like Khan Academy, Byju''''s, self-practice workbooks, reference books on advanced school mathematics for teachers
Career Connection
Deep content mastery is fundamental for confidence in teaching, effectively answering student queries, designing robust mathematical activities, and ultimately fostering a strong learning environment.
Develop Effective Communication & Presentation Skills- (Semester 1-2)
Actively participate in classroom discussions, mock teaching sessions, and seminars. Seek feedback on your clarity, voice modulation, and engagement techniques. Practice explaining complex mathematical ideas simply and engagingly to diverse audiences.
Tools & Resources
Public speaking clubs (if available), peer review, video recording and self-assessment, practicing lesson explanations with family/friends, presentation software
Career Connection
Excellent communication is paramount for effective teaching, maintaining classroom discipline, and successful interactions with students, parents, and school administration, critical for securing and excelling in teaching roles.
Intermediate Stage
Engage in Intensive Teaching Internships- (Semester 3-4 (Internship Phases I & II))
Maximize learning during school internships by observing experienced teachers, co-teaching, taking full classes, and experimenting with various teaching methodologies for mathematics. Document daily reflections and actively seek mentor feedback to refine your teaching skills.
Tools & Resources
Internship school resources, mentor teachers, B.Ed practical handbooks, reflective journals, detailed lesson plan templates
Career Connection
Hands-on teaching experience is the most critical component for building practical skills, developing classroom presence, and is often a key criterion for school recruitment and successful long-term career progression.
Innovate with Digital Tools for Math Education- (Semester 3-4)
Explore and integrate educational technology (EdTech) tools like GeoGebra, Desmos, interactive whiteboards, and online quiz platforms into your mathematics lesson plans. Learn to create engaging digital content to make abstract mathematical concepts more accessible.
Tools & Resources
GeoGebra, Desmos, Kahoot, Quizizz, YouTube for educational content, simple animation software, learning management systems
Career Connection
Proficiency in EdTech makes you a more versatile and attractive candidate for modern schools in India, especially with the growing emphasis on blended learning and digital literacy as per the NEP 2020.
Undertake Action Research in a Classroom Setting- (Semester 3-4)
Identify a specific teaching-learning problem in a mathematics classroom during your internship (e.g., difficulty with fractions). Design and implement a small-scale action research project to address it, analyzing outcomes and refining strategies for improved learning.
Tools & Resources
Academic journals on education research, research methodology textbooks, mentor teacher guidance, data collection tools (surveys, observation checklists)
Career Connection
Action research skills demonstrate problem-solving abilities, a reflective teaching approach, and a commitment to continuous professional development, qualities highly valued by progressive educational institutions.
Advanced Stage
Prepare for Teacher Eligibility Tests (TETs/CTET)- (Semester 4 (concurrent with final internship))
Begin rigorous preparation for national (CTET) and state-level (TET) teacher eligibility exams well in advance. Focus on subject-specific pedagogy and general education sections, utilizing previous year papers and taking numerous mock tests for time management and accuracy.
Tools & Resources
Official CTET/TET syllabi, previous year question papers, online coaching platforms, specialized guidebooks and study materials
Career Connection
Clearing TET/CTET is a mandatory requirement for teaching positions in government and many private schools across India, making it a critical step for securing employment and career advancement.
Develop a Professional Teaching Portfolio- (Semester 4)
Compile a comprehensive portfolio showcasing your best lesson plans, innovative teaching aids, student work samples, reflection journals, teaching certificates, and any innovative projects undertaken during the program. This serves as a tangible demonstration of your skills.
Tools & Resources
Digital portfolio platforms (e.g., Google Sites, Canva), organized physical binders, high-quality documentation (photos, videos) of your teaching practices
Career Connection
A well-structured teaching portfolio is a powerful tool during job interviews, demonstrating your practical skills, creativity, and readiness for a teaching role more effectively than a resume alone.
